Holden V8 Supercar - Thunder Saloons - Race One - Brands GP - 28/06/25 - Super Touring Power 3 - Finished Second. Unfortunately, despite having thought we had got to the bottom of the GoPro 9 over heating and shutting off partway through the races, it seems we had not, or it was just too hot. So this is only part of the race. Day one of the Super Touring Power 3 event Brands Hatch on the GP Circuit ended with a couple of extra trophies, but it wasn't easy. We started qualifying on a fresh set of slicks, which needed afew laps to scrub in. Unfortunately, after two laps the saftey car came out due to a car stranded in the gravel, before that could be recovered another car broke down and they red flagged the session. We never got a chance to put in a flying lap and started 8th. Race One and Alex was on the outside of the grid, then the usual issue of not being able to get on it until the tyres come up to temp. This dropped us back to 12th. Once there was actually some grip to press on, the big Holden started picking off cars and was up to 3rd with one lap to go. This is when there was an unfortunate incident. Hot on the tail of second place Andy Robinson in his AU Falcon, they had slight contact (the lightest touch, with no damage), which, turned Andy around. Turning left and with the rear unloaded, it didn't take a lot to unsettle the car. A complete accident and a sad racing incident. First place was too far up the road to catch on the last lap. We did finish second, however with Alex feeling so bad about the contact, he handed the trophy to Andy.
